+/*
+ * I2C communication
+ *
+ * The AB3100 is usually assigned address 0x48 (7-bit)
+ * The chip is defined in the platform i2c_board_data section.
+ */
+static int ab3100_get_chip_id(struct device *dev)
+{
+       struct ab3100 *ab3100 = dev_get_drvdata(dev->parent);
+
+       return (int)ab3100->chip_id;
+}
+
+static int ab3100_set_register_interruptible(struct ab3100 *ab3100,
+       u8 reg, u8 regval)
+{
+       u8 regandval[2] = {reg, regval};
+       int err;
+
+       err = mutex_lock_interruptible(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+       if (err)
+               return err;
+
+       /*
+        * A two-byte write message with the first byte containing the register
+        * number and the second byte containing the value to be written
+        * effectively sets a register in the AB3100.
+        */
+       err = i2c_master_send(ab3100->i2c_client, regandval, 2);
+       if (err < 0)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(write register): %d\n",
+                       err);
+       } else if (err != 2)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(write register)\n"
+                       "  %d bytes transferred (expected 2)\n",
+                       err);
+               err = -EIO;
+       } else {
+               /* All is well */
+               err = 0;
+       }
+       mutex_unlock(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+       return err;
+}
+
+static int set_register_interruptible(struct device *dev,
+       u8 bank, u8 reg, u8 value)
+{
+       struct ab3100 *ab3100 = dev_get_drvdata(dev->parent);
+
+       return ab3100_set_register_interruptible(ab3100, reg, value);
+}
+
+/*
+ * The test registers exist at an I2C bus address up one
+ * from the ordinary base. They are not supposed to be used
+ * in production code, but sometimes you have to do that
+ * anyway. It's currently only used from this file so declare
+ * it static and do not export.
+ */
+static int ab3100_set_test_register_interruptible(struct ab3100 *ab3100,
+                                   u8 reg, u8 regval)
+{
+       u8 regandval[2] = {reg, regval};
+       int err;
+
+       err = mutex_lock_interruptible(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+       if (err)
+               return err;
+
+       err = i2c_master_send(ab3100->testreg_client, regandval, 2);
+       if (err < 0)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(write test register): %d\n",
+                       err);
+       } else if (err != 2)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(write test register)\n"
+                       "  %d bytes transferred (expected 2)\n",
+                       err);
+               err = -EIO;
+       } else {
+               /* All is well */
+               err = 0;
+       }
+       mutex_unlock(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+
+       return err;
+}
+
+static int ab3100_get_register_interruptible(struct ab3100 *ab3100,
+                                            u8 reg, u8 *regval)
+{
+       int err;
+
+       err = mutex_lock_interruptible(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+       if (err)
+               return err;
+
+       /*
+        * AB3100 require an I2C "stop" command between each message, else
+        * it will not work. The only way of achieveing this with the
+        * message transport layer is to send the read and write messages
+        * separately.
+        */
+       err = i2c_master_send(ab3100->i2c_client, &reg, 1);
+       if (err < 0)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(send register address): %d\n",
+                       err);
+               goto get_reg_out_unlock;
+       } else if (err != 1)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(send register address)\n"
+                       "  %d bytes transferred (expected 1)\n",
+                       err);
+               err = -EIO;
+               goto get_reg_out_unlock;
+       } else {
+               /* All is well */
+               err = 0;
+       }
+
+       err = i2c_master_recv(ab3100->i2c_client, regval, 1);
+       if (err < 0)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(read register): %d\n",
+                       err);
+               goto get_reg_out_unlock;
+       } else if (err != 1) {
+               dev_err(ab3100->dev,
+                       "write error (read register)\n"
+                       "  %d bytes transferred (expected 1)\n",
+                       err);
+               err = -EIO;
+               goto get_reg_out_unlock;
+       } else {
+               /* All is well */
+               err = 0;
+       }
+
+ get_reg_out_unlock:
+       mutex_unlock(&ab3100->access_mutex);
+       return err;
+}

+/*
+ * This is a threaded interrupt handler so we can make some
+ * I2C calls etc.
+ */
+static irqreturn_t ab3100_irq_handler(int irq, void *data)
+{
+       struct ab3100 *ab3100 = data;
+       u8 event_regs[3];
+       u32 fatevent;
+       int err;
+
+       err = ab3100_get_register_page_interruptible(ab3100, AB3100_EVENTA1,
+                                      event_regs, 3);
+       if (err)
+               goto err_event;
+
+       fatevent = (event_regs[0] << 16) |
+               (event_regs[1] << 8) |
+               event_regs[2];
+
+       if (!ab3100->startup_events_read) {
+               ab3100->startup_events[0] = event_regs[0];
+               ab3100->startup_events[1] = event_regs[1];
+               ab3100->startup_events[2] = event_regs[2];
+               ab3100->startup_events_read = true;
+       }
+       /*
+        * The notified parties will have to mask out the events
+        * they're interested in and react to them. They will be
+        * notified on all events, then they use the fatevent value
+        * to determine if they're interested.
+        */
+       blocking_notifier_call_chain(&ab3100->event_subscribers,
+                                    fatevent, NULL);
+
+       dev_dbg(ab3100->dev,
+               "IRQ Event: 0x%08x\n", fatevent);
+
+       return IRQ_HANDLED;
+
+ err_event:
+       dev_dbg(ab3100->dev,
+               "error reading event status\n");
+       return IRQ_HANDLED;
+}

+/*
+ * Basic set-up, datastructure creation/destruction and I2C interface.
+ * This sets up a default config in the AB3100 chip so that it
+ * will work as expected.
+ */
+
+struct ab3100_init_setting {
+       u8 abreg;
+       u8 setting;
+};
+
+static const struct ab3100_init_setting ab3100_init_settings[] = {
+       {
+               .abreg = AB3100_MCA,
+               .setting = 0x01
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_MCB,
+               .setting = 0x30
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RA1,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RA2,
+               .setting = 0xFF
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RA3,
+               .setting = 0x01
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RB1,
+               .setting = 0xBF
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RB2,
+               .setting = 0xFF
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_IMRB3,
+               .setting = 0xFF
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_SUP,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_DIS,
+               .setting = 0xF0
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_D0C,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_D1C,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_D2C,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       }, {
+               .abreg = AB3100_D3C,
+               .setting = 0x00
+       },
+};
+
+static int ab3100_setup(struct ab3100 *ab3100)
+{
+       int err = 0;
+       int i;
+
+       for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(ab3100_init_settings); i++) {
+               err = ab3100_set_register_interruptible(ab3100,
+                                         ab3100_init_settings[i].abreg,
+                                         ab3100_init_settings[i].setting);
+               if (err)
+                       goto exit_no_setup;
+       }
+
+       /*
+        * Special trick to make the AB3100 use the 32kHz clock (RTC)
+        * bit 3 in test register 0x02 is a special, undocumented test
+        * register bit that only exist in AB3100 P1E
+        */
+       if (ab3100->chip_id == 0xc4) {
+               dev_warn(ab3100->dev,
+                        "AB3100 P1E variant detected forcing chip to 32KHz\n");
+               err = ab3100_set_test_register_interruptible(ab3100,
+                       0x02, 0x08);
+       }
+
+ exit_no_setup:
+       return err;
+}
